CALGARY, Alberta—FYidoctors has promoted Michael Naugle, OD to its management team. The company also announced a new VP of its Delta Ophthalmic Laboratory.

Naugle has been promoted to the role of VP of optometric partnerships. This promotion places Dr. Naugle in the primary role of growing the company in Canada and adding valuable members to the FYidoctors team, the company said.

Naugle was the managing partner of one of the largest optometric practices in Atlantic Canada before joining FYidoctors in 2008. As a past member of the FYidoctors board of directors, Naugle has served as vice chair, chairman of the governance and compensation committee, vice chairman of the advisory committee, and chair of the nominating committee of the advisory committee.

Naugle acquired his Bachelor of Science Degree with honors from the University of New Brunswick. He then attended the University of Waterloo where he received his doctorate of Optometry with honors in 1992. Since 1996, Naugle has served on the Council of New Brunswick Association of Optometrists, including two years as president from 2000-2002.

In addition, FYidoctors announced the appointment of Nancy Morison as vice president, Delta Ophthalmic Laboratory at the group’s Delta manufacturing and distribution facility.

Morison brings significant expertise in supply chain logistics, IT, and overall product management from many organizations including Loomis and i2 Technologies, the company’s announcement said, adding that she was instrumental in the growth of Coastal/Clearly over the period of 2003 to 2015 where she grew to the position of chief operating officer. Her most recent tenure was with SPUD.ca, an omni channel specialty grocer.

FYidoctors is one of the world’s largest doctor-owned provider of ophthalmic products and services, with over 525 optometrists servicing over 200 locations, a private, optometrist-owned and operated eyecare company.
